About The Position

Umoja Biopharma is seeking a passionate and capable Logistics Associate to join our Supply Chain team. As a member of the Supply Chain group, you will be cross-functionally integral with many departments, such as Process Sciences, Manufacturing, Quality Assurance, and the Quality Control Laboratories, to ensure that all the shipping needs of the business are met. The Logistics Associate will be primarily tasked with the management of all outgoing shipments to support both GxP as well as non-GxP Laboratory functionality. Shipments of Drug Substance, Drug Product, Sterile Diluent, and other GxP samples as well as Vendor Material Returns, and Laboratory Samples will be under their purview. The successful candidate will partner closely with stakeholders to anticipate needs, resolve issues quickly, and deliver consistent, high-quality service-based experience. The role will also be required to follow SOPs for all GxP governed shipments. We are looking for someone who takes ownership, communicates clearly, and works collaboratively to ensure our partners receive timely and effective support. Additional activities may include supporting warehouse general receipt and materials handling such as picking, putaway, counting, and other operations as required. Feedback on and iterative improvements for Umoja warehouse/shipping processes. Ideal candidate will have good communication skills, be highly organized, and detail oriented. Prior experience with a GMP environment, experience with DOT and IATA shipping regulations, and Cold Chain Shipping highly preferred. This role will support supply chain activities, reporting to the Associate Director, Supply Chain onsite 5 days/week in Louisville, CO.

Responsibilities

  • Correct and timely shipment of GMP and non-GMP materials from The CLIMB Warehouse in Louisville, CO to destinations across the globe.
  • Assist in maintaining a safe, clean, and orderly warehouse in support of manufacturing activity
  • Coordinate and oversee GMP and Non-GMP material packing and shipping operations.
  • Support the External Quality and Purchasing Groups when coordinating and tracking outgoing shipments
  • Perform activities according to and in compliance with Umoja SOPs and Quality Systems
  • Maintain current certifications for DOT/IATA shipping requirements
  • Safely operate machinery such as forklifts and order pickers
  • Collaborate with other departments like Process Sciences, Quality Assurance, and Quality Control Laboratories to ensure all shipping needs are met
  • Demonstrate proactive, service-oriented mindset and the ability to work effectively with cross functional partners.
  • Monitor key performance indicators and solutions to ensure operational excellence, continuous improvement, and timely communications
  • Assist in creating dashboards and visual management systems as needed to ensure successful operations
